Rick was my friend. I met him in at the beginning of 2015 and we became quick friends. He was reluctant to come along on that first trip of ours, but he did and everyone bonded quickly. He immediately moved down to Columbus to stay with me, so he could hang out with his new friends and get more involved in our mission. He was there with me when I got word that my brother had died. He "happily" bought up all my guns to help fund my trip to Everest. And he was loved by everyone. I still remember vividly that first trip on Mount Elbert you were like, nope... going to the tree line and that's it! When we returned in 2018 you beat us all to the top! I am going to miss you dearly Rick. The memories and moments we shared together will never be forgotten, and neither will you. Rest easy my brother. - Mike
